The Service Center and Monitoring Center are located at the SPEL company premises in Kolín. This facility enables us to respond quickly, coordinate effectively, and provide a high level of service. Our goal is to ensure the reliable, safe, and smooth operation of all managed systems.
Thanks to remote monitoring, we can quickly advise, diagnose a fault, and in many cases, resolve it without the need for an on-site service visit. This significantly shortens response times and contributes to the smooth operation of the managed technologies.
We monitor the network of highway emergency SOS phones, camera systems, tunnel technologies, security systems, automatic traffic counters, weigh-in-motion (WIM) systems, and other telematics equipment. All technology is clearly displayed in intuitive visualizations, enabling operators to respond quickly to arising situations.
We regularly ensure the inspection and maintenance of equipment in compliance with applicable standards and regulations. We place the highest emphasis on emergency SOS phones as a key safety element of the highway infrastructure.
Our service offerings also include checking calls to the 112 emergency line, electrical installations, servers, switches, variable message signs (VMS), thermometers, warning signs, camera systems, electronic security systems (ESS), tunnel technologies, and other equipment within service contracts.
At the same time, our service department technicians have an immediate overview of active jobs and the current status of the managed systems.
Tunnel Maintenance and Service We perform the servicing of tunnel technologies regularly according to the valid Schedule. We inspect all systems installed by SPEL, ensure the calibration of camera systems, check tunnel SOS phones, cameras, fans, server and switch configurations, as well as the servicing of control systems.
WIM Calibration and Certification We carry out inspections of data storage into superior systems, check-weighing, and subsequent calibration of WIM systems to ensure their accurate and reliable operation.

SPEL a.s. provides service support in the field of industrial automation, including PLC and SCADA system maintenance, fault diagnostics of technological systems, remote management, and support for industrial operations.
The service department performs maintenance and repairs of control systems, resolves industrial network communication issues, carries out PLC program backups and recovery, provides SCADA/HMI visualization service, and handles emergency on-site interventions.
Our activities also include system commissioning, modernization of legacy systems, and technical support for production, energy, and infrastructure facilities.
